In this episode of The Bernard Lee Poker Show on the Cardplayer Lifestyle Podcast Family, Bernard Lee conducts his annual Question and Answer (Q&A) show where he answers numerous questions that have been submitted to him by his loyal listeners throughout the last couple of years (as the show didn’t have one last year due to COVID 19 pandemic).

During the show, Bernard discusses topics that range from his radio show, his latest book, Poker Satellite Success, WSOP advice, hosting mixed games in New Hampshire, online poker, and future plans.

Bernard Lee is a professional poker player who has more than $2.5 million and ten titles since turning pro following his 13th finish in the 2005 WSOP Main Event.
